  2. THE AIM OF JUNIOR BEST The aim of Junior BEST is to make sure that the children and young people from all the schools in the development group have regular input and shape the development of Extended Services.

  3. At Junior BEST we were given a mission…… To find out what local facilities children in our school wanted. We asked the whole school for their views. We sent a questionnaire to each class in the school.  We consulted with thirteen classes, each class filled in the questionnaire. These were the four main choices:

  4. The four main choices in our school: 1. Graffiti Board, we can take our own paints and do graffiti legally. 2. Skate Park and lessons, improvements to the skate park to include good lighting and security and a safe environment also an organised club so you can skate properly . 3. A secure and safe play area undercover open at all times when adults are shopping in Quorn. 4. Dancing Hall, open to everyone who would like to learn how to dance in different ways. This hall could also be used for many other activities.
